继续浏览精彩内容
慕课网APP
程序员的梦工厂
打开
继续
感谢您的支持,我会继续努力的
赞赏金额会直接到老师账户
将二维码发送给自己后长按识别
微信支付
支付宝支付

"查询结果数据无目标:如何解决常见问题"

倚天杖
关注TA
已关注
手记 371
粉丝 48
获赞 189
query has no destination for result data

在IT领域,当程序员执行查询(query)操作时,可能会遇到“query has no destination for result data”的错误。这个错误通常意味着查询没有指定结果数据的存储位置。本文将详细介绍这个错误,并提供一些解决方案,帮助程序员解决这一问题。

错误原因

当执行查询操作时,如果没有指定结果数据的存储位置,可能会导致“query has no destination for result data”的错误。这可能是因为查询语句中没有包含INTO关键字,或者INTO关键字后面的表名或视图名不正确。

解决方案

要解决这个问题,可以采取以下措施:

  1. 检查查询语句是否包含INTO关键字。如果没有,请添加INTO关键字,并指定结果数据的存储位置。例如:

    SELECT *
    INTO NewTable
    FROM OriginalTable
    WHERE Condition;
  2. 确保INTO关键字后面的表名或视图名正确。如果表名或视图名不正确,将导致查询失败。请检查表名或视图名是否正确,并在必要时进行修改。

  3. 如果查询中包含子查询,请确保子查询中也包含INTO关键字。子查询中的INTO关键字必须位于子查询的末尾,以便将子查询的结果存储在临时表中。

  4. 如果查询是为了创建视图,请确保视图名正确,并在视图名后面添加AS关键字。例如:

    CREATE VIEW NewView AS
    SELECT *
    FROM OriginalTable
    WHERE Condition;
  5. 如果以上方法都无法解决问题,请尝试重新编写查询语句。有时,重新编写查询语句可以解决潜在的语法错误或逻辑错误。
总结

当遇到“query has no destination for result data”错误时,请检查查询语句是否包含INTO关键字,以及INTO关键字后面的表名或视图名是否正确。通过采取上述解决方案,你可以解决这个问题,并顺利执行查询操作。

打开App,阅读手记
0人推荐
发表评论
随时随地看视频慕课网APP